Jared Picarella Obituary

Jared T. Picarella Loving son, brother and uncle Middlesex/Naples - Jared T. Picarella, age 28, passed away unexpectedly on Saturday, Feb. 14, 2009. Jared was born Sept. 29, 1980 in Rochester and was a son of John J. and Debra S. (Sykes) Picarella. He was a graduate of Naples Central School and also attended Calvin College and Cornerstone University in Grand Rapids, Mich. Most recently, he was attending Keuka College. Jared worked for several construction companies in various positions in Michigan and at Bristol Builders. He attended Bristol Springs Free Church. Jared enjoyed snow skiing, hiking and swimming. He was predeceased by his brother, Zachary J. Picarella on June 6, 1993. He is survived by his parents, John and Debra Picarella of Middlesex; sister, Jessica (Daniel) Donnelly; and nephew, Zachary Donnelly, both of Phillipsburg, N.J.; paternal grandparents, John and Stella Picarella of Westwood, N.J.; and several aunts, uncles and cousins.
